下面的浏览式修改,到底那里出问题?有原因!
<%@language="vbscript"%>
<HTML>
<head><title>修改界面</title>
</head>
<body>
<%
dim conn,connstr
dim rs,k
db="xyxinxi.mdb"
Set conn = Server.CreateObject("ADODB.Connection")
connstr="driver={Microsoft Access Driver (*.mdb)};dbq=" & Server.MapPath(db)
conn.Open connstr
Set rs= Server.CreateObject("ADODB.Recordset")
rs.open session("rsupdate1"),conn,3,3
k=0
do while not rs.eof
'm=rs.abos
k=k+1
if request.form<>"" then
BH="T1"&k
rs("姓名").value=request.form(BH)
SM="T2"&k
rs("性别").value=request.form(SM)
ZZ="T3"&k
rs("工作单位").value=request.form(ZZ)
JJ="T4"&K
rs("职务").value=request.form(JJ)
CBS="T5"&k
rs("职称").value=request.form(CBS)
FF="T6"&K
rs("通讯地址").value=request.form(FF)
KK="T7"&K
rs("联系电话").value=request.form(KK)
YY="T8"&K
rs("邮编").value=request.form(YY)
LL="T9"&K
rs("电子信箱").value=request.form(LL)
HH="T10"&K
rs("毕业时间").value=request.form(HH)
MM="T11"&K
rs("毕业专业").value=request.form(MM)
DD="T12"&K
rs("班级").value=request.form(DD)
BB="T13"&K
rs("学历").value=request.form(BB)
PP="T14"&K
rs("arrived").value=request.form(PP)
end if
rs.movenext '为55行
loop
rs.updatebatch
rs.close
set conn=nothing
set rs=nothing
response.redirect "/bookasp/gongdaxiaoqin.asp?name="&session("name2") '要从luru.asp获得session("name")
%>
</body>
</html>
错误原因:
技术信息(适用于支持人员)
错误类型:
Microsoft JET Database Engine (0x80040E21)
/456/asp/rsupdate.asp, 第 55 行
浏览器类型:
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.0)
页:
POST 2195 bytes to /456/asp/rsupdate.asp
POST 数据:
T11=%C9%EA%CD%C0%B4%AC%C7%E5&T21=%C4%D0&T31=%CD%A9%C2%AE%BB%E3%B7%E1%C9%FA%CE%EF%BB%AF%B9%A4%D3%D0%CF%DE%B9%AB%CB%BE&T41=NULL&T51=NULL&T61=NULL&T71=0571-64201509&T81=NULL&T91=NULL&T101=1996%C4%EA&T111 . . .
时间:
2003年10月9日, 11:17:41
详细信息:
Microsoft 支持